AN ORDINANCE AUTHORIZING THE EMPLOYMENT OF RICHARD CRAIG SLAUGHTER AS A FULL-TIME BUILDING OFFICIAL IN THE CO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T DEPARTMENT AND ESTABLISHING A SALARY AND START DATE FOR SUCH EMPLOYEE WHEREAS, City Code Section 110.070 provides for the appointment of employees of the City by the City Administrator with approval of the Mayor and Board of Aldermen; and WHEREAS, City Code Section 110.140 provides for the establishment of the salary of non- elected employees of the City by ordinance; and WHEREAS, the Board of Aldermen find it is in the best interest of the City to approve the appointment of Richard Craig Slaughter as Building Official in the Community Development Department as provided herein; NOW TH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E BOARD OF ALDERMEN OF THE CITY OF RIVERSIDE, MISSOURI, AS FOLLOWS: SECTION 1 — HIRING OF EMPLOYEE. Richard Craig Slaughter is hereby employed as a Building Official in the Community Development Department. SECTION 2 — STARTING SALARY. The starting salary for this position shall be set at $65,000 per year. The salary shall thereafter be adjusted according to the annual budget and the personnel policies and procedures of the City as may be adopted from time to time. SECTION 3 - REPEAL OF ORDINANCES IN CONFLICT. All ordinances or parts of ordinances in conflict with this ordinance are hereby repealed. SECTION 4—SEVERABILITY CLAUSE. The provisions of this ordinance are severable and if any provision hereof is declared invalid, unconstitutional or unenforceable, such determination shall not affect the validity of the remainder of this ordinance. SECTION 5— EFFECTIVE DATE. This ordinance shall be in full force and effect as of September 28, 2018. BE IT REMEMBERED that the above was read two times by heading only, passed and approved by a majority of the Board of Aldermen and APPROVED by the Mayor of the City of Riverside, Missouri, this 25'" day of September 2018.
